Scotland’s CSignum secures €6.9M to advance underwater wireless networks 

|

|

Last update:

Bathgate, Scotland-based CSignum, a company specialised in wireless technology extending IoT communications beneath the surface, has secured £6M (approximately €6.9M) in a Series A funding round. 

The funding round was led by Archangels, Par Equity, and Scottish Enterprise with additional investment from British Business Investment (BBI), Raptor Group, Deep Future, SeaAhead’s Blue Angel Network, and notable individual US investors.

Archangels is a business angel syndicate investing in early-stage Scottish life sciences and technology companies. There are currently 20 companies within the portfolio.

Dan McKiddie, Investment Manager at Archangels, says, “CSignum has developed a truly unique technological breakthrough which could be a game-changer for those industries reliant on securing reliable data from their underwater operations. We’re looking forward to supporting the management team in their efforts to scale the business and disrupt the global market for underwater communication.”

Fund utilisation

The company will use the funds to grow its EM-2 product line, which improves how wireless sensor data is sent from underwater to above-water networks.

This investment will also help the Scottish company to expand globally, speed up product development, and meet the rising need for reliable, real-time data transmission in underwater and underground settings.

The company plans to add additional staff in the UK, USA, and EU over the next year as it continues to scale its operations.

Jonathan Reeves CEO at CSignum says, “This investment reflects the growing recognition of the critical need for innovative communication solutions in the underwater IoT sector. The support from our investors will allow us to scale our operations, enhance our product offerings, and help industries worldwide manage their resources more effectively. We are grateful for their trust and excited to shape the future of underwater communication.”

CSignum: Advancing wireless technology communication

Led by Jonathan Reeves, CSignum is a wireless IoT communication solution for submerged environments.

The company’s technology eliminates the need for traditional cables, enabling reliable, real-time data transfer and reducing operational costs for industries such as utilities, maritime, offshore energy, and environmental monitoring. 

CSignum’s EM-2 solutions can send data reliably through difficult environments like water, ice, soil, rock, and concrete to networks above ground.

EM-2 systems are useful for monitoring water quality and the environment, checking conditions under ships, and ensuring security for vital underwater infrastructure, including offshore wind turbines and oil and gas platforms.

The company also offers CSignum Cloud, providing data services to complement its wireless systems. 

So far, the company’s dashboard and analytics have been deployed on several river water quality monitoring projects.

CSignum is working with customers in the UK, EU, and US markets.
